What makes my portrait photography different?
I want your experience with me to be just as memorable as the photos themselves. Crack a joke, share a story, talk about your favorite movie, or any other any other catalyst that makes your spirit shine. Some of my favorite photos come happen in-between poses where neither of us were expecting it.
I make a conscious effort to be adaptable to my clients. This means using various perspectives and lighting techniques to match the subject’s personality. What’s different about me is that I’m also a video editor. I can put your stills into motion via custom reels to help elevate your story. I am very transparent with my clients. I always ask ahead of time what they are looking for so that I may plan accordingly. I also like to try different things during photo shoots such as different perspectives, expressions, and a whatever our imaginations can cook up.
Here are a few about my workflow:
I encourage my clients to come to the table with their own ideas, and experiment.
My approach to editing is fairly straightforward using a combination of standard color, and black and white. As needed, I may branch out and stylize the photo further depending on the client’s preferences.
Photo touch-ups often include the following:
Minor blemish removal
Minor skin-smoothing and frequency separation
Dodging and burning (light and dark balancing)
Skin tone and overall color balancing
Stray hair removal/management
AI: Only used as needed. Generally, I use it for removing potentially unwanted elements that sneak into the photo.
Photos are shot in RAW format for maximum detail and color representation.
I generally don’t use props. However, I do encourage clients with a particular vocation (guitarist, dancer, etc…) to work with me on expressing their craft.
All photos are edited with a combination of Adobe Lightroom and Photoshop.
I produce all edited images in multiple formats including maximum resolution for large scale prints, and smaller versions optimized for social media.
